Melanotic paraganglioma of the posterior mediastinum

Abstract:A melanotic paraganglioma occurred in a 57-year-old woman, located in the left paravertebral space of the upper mediastinum. It was totally resected. During a 5 year follow up period neither tumour reccurrence nor metastasis were observed. Histological examination of the tumour revealed a paraganglioma with monomorphous chief cell like elements which were arranged in a ldquozellballenrdquo pattern. Immunohistochemical results also were in accordance with the diagnosis since neuron-specific enolase, chromogranin and synaptophysin were found in tumour cells whereas keratin was not. Additionally, neurosecretory granules were found in tumour cells during electron microscopy. A peculiar feature of the tumour was its strong pigmentation due to melanin located within the tumour cells and tumour associated melanophages. The simultaneous expression of functional properties of two different neural crest derived cells in one tumour stresses the close relationship between all neural crest elements and is in accordance with the observation of other melanotic, non-melanomatous tumours.Dedicated to Prof. Dr. Dr. mult. h.c.
